以Pager的形式填充到ViewPager

2021-08-11 03:52:02 字數 1130 閱讀 6231

1.自定義pager,設定要返回的view的方法為抽象方法,並將返回的view

2.設定viewpager的adapter

關鍵**如下:

public  abstract  class basepager 

//定義為抽象方法,子類繼承該類必須要實現的方法

public abstract view initview();

//子類繼承該類可實現也可不實現

public void initdata()

}

public class vpadapter extends pageradapter 

@override

public int getcount()

@override

public boolean isviewfromobject(view view, object object)

@override

public object instantiateitem(viewgroup container, int position)

@override

public void destroyitem(viewgroup container, int position, object object)

}

mvpcontent.addonpagechangelistener(new viewpager.onpagechangelistener() 

@override

public void onpageselected(int position)

@override

public void onpagescrollstatechanged(int state)

});

public class homepager extends basepager 

@override

public view initview()

@override

public void initdata()

}

demo源**:

JAVA中將A類的值填充到B類

在 中我們有時遇到a類的值填充到b類,對於乙個新手程式設計師第乙個想到的就是利用實體類裡的get set方法,乙個乙個的去注入進去,其實 有一種更快捷的方法 當然 前提是變數名一致的情況下 import org.apache.commons.beanutils.beanutils testdo d ...

將文字中內容以列形式填充入excel

文字內容,文字內容必需為有規律的間隔。2014 1 2 208 2014 1 3 208 2014 1 4 208 2014 1 5 208 2014 1 6 208 2014 1 7 208 2014 1 8 208 在excel中開啟剛才儲存的文字檔案,出現 文字匯入嚮導 3步驟之1 對話方塊,...

將字串不足長度的填充到指定長度

str pad 使用另乙個字串填充字串為指定長度 使用 stringstr pad string input,int pad length string pad string int pad type str pad right 說明 該函式返回input被從左端 右端或者同時兩端被填充到制定長度後...